Transaction 34c79b1522c854bb0405360b019599c1d3a8781ffd04a2e3ebb68c72aa22cd95

1 Input
2 Outputs
  • 34c79b1522c854bb0405360b019599c1d3a8781ffd04a2e3ebb68c72aa22cd95:0
  • value  41340000
    address  1Fk7ChbDpeu47RtRGwsv79UEe11EB45GzR
  • 34c79b1522c854bb0405360b019599c1d3a8781ffd04a2e3ebb68c72aa22cd95:1
  • value  252636168
    address  12D4R6KaMeNVeGwuYn9w4Bat7SbxyQHpoB